I first noticed the original Give’r gloves in the lift line at our local ski resort, Grand Targhee. The branded silhouette of the Teton Range caught my eye.  I remember thinking ‘that’s a good idea’.  Little did I know that just a few months later I’d be working as Garage Grown Gear’s store manager, sending out hundreds of Give’r glove orders.

The original Give’r glove is a good-quality insulated leather glove that comes custom branded with your initials, in addition to that silhouette of the Tetons. It’s the kind of glove you see out West a lot, whether in the lift line, at the loading dock, or on the dashboard of a flatbed pickup truck.

In December, I got the chance to meet the founder of Give’r, Bubba Albrecht, at the Give’r world headquarters in Jackson Wyoming. I was surprised to find that Bubba wasn’t resting on his laurels.  Next to stacks of the original Give’r gloves waiting to be branded, Bubba had prototypes of new 4-Season Give’r glove, now on Kickstarter.

 

The 4-season Give’r glove was designed from the ground up to be everything Bubba and his team ever wanted in a glove: comfortable, versatile, durable, waterproof, leather, and insulated. It’s a glove made for the Give'r in us all.

Well, they clearly hit the nail on the head, because their Kickstarter project to bring the 4-Season glove to life was funded in a matter of hours.  As of today, they’ve more than quadrupled their $25,000 goal with $102,000 in funding committed. Bubba was nice enough to send me a pair for the new 4-season Give’r gloves to test out. I’ve had the gloves for just a week but in true mountain town style I’ve already used them for: snowmobiling, skiing, splitting wood, driving, walking around town, and working in the garage.

The bottom line: The new 4-season Give’r gloves already found their spot on the dashboard of my truck. I’ve owned a lot of insulated leather gloves over the years, and even though I’ve only had the 4-season Give’r gloves a few days I can say, without a doubt, these really are the best damn gloves ever.

4-Season Gloves Give'r

Pros of the new 4-season Give’r gloves:

  • 100% Waterproof
  • Great fit
  • High Quality
  • Warm
  • Branded initials make them fun
  • They come waxed and ready to go

 

Cons:

  • Protective wax coating limits breathability
